More than 13 million people are suffering as a result of drought and famine in the Horn of Africa. Thanks to your donations, Y Care International's partners Norwegian Church Aid (NCA) and The Lutheran World Federation (LWF) are providing life-saving humanitarian aid supplying life-saving food, water, medical care and shelter to people fleeing the drought.

What is being done?
NCA has distributed packages to thousands of households affected by fighting between militia groups and government forces. In one Somali district over 30,000 people have received food items and 4,000 people, mostly women, were provided with life-saving water – 5 litres per person per day.

LWF manages Dadaab’s site planning, camp peace and security. New arrivals are searched for weapons so that camps are not infiltrated by armed militia groups. Families fleeing famine and conflict get life-saving emergency help. Fatouma Mohammed, 50, left Somalia a month ago with her daughter and the eight children they have between them:

“I am pleased that the agencies will help us to settle somewhere,” she said. “I hope at some time they will help me to build a durable structure to live in, but now I am very happy to have a tent.”

And both NCA and LWF plan to do more – with your help. Donations from Y Care International’s supporters will provide refugees with packages including rice, beans and vegetable oil as well as blankets, plastic sheets, mosquito nets, soap, water jerry cans and sleeping mats. We will also be contributing to long-term solutions such as providing farmers with livestock and drought-resistant crop seeds like beans and maize so that livelihoods can be rebuilt.
